Runbook fragment — Connection pooling on the Orchalis API tier

Quick heads-up for anyone reviewing pool changes: each Orchalis API pod holds a pool of 20 connections to the Fernwick database, and we're close to the server-side cap. If your change adds a new pool or bumps sizes, do the math on total connections across all replicas first — we've tipped over twice. Exhaustion shows up as timeouts, not errors, so it's sneaky. Current limits and sizing guidance are kept on this internal page:

runbook for tafof-yawif: https://confluence.tolvaqsys.internal/display/display/browse/pages/7be3

Action item: The Relayn deploy-status bot silently dropped updates when the pipeline API paginated results, so responders believed a rollback had completed when it had not. We will add pagination handling, a staleness banner, and an integration test. Until merged, verify deploy state directly in the pipeline console, documented at the page below.

runbook for kahop-kajop: https://rundeck.ordinio.test/display/secrets/pipeline/issue/pages/repo/browse/e5732776e07d1285107e5aeb

Subject: Reminder job v2 is live

Hey release channel — quick heads-up for the new folks: the Willowmere Clinic appointment reminder job now runs through Pagewell instead of the old scheduler. It fires at 7am clinic-local time and batches SMS and email together. If a patient reports a missing reminder, check the job's run log before escalating. The deploy that enabled this carries a trace token, shown below.

pipeline stamp: htk21_86b657ac0aa916a9af17f

Handover: Weather-Alert Fan-Out (Stormcourier)

Handing this off before I rotate to the Bellgrave team. Stormcourier fans out severe-weather alerts to roughly forty downstream subscribers via the Plumline bus. Key thing to know: fan-out is at-least-once, so subscribers must dedupe on alert ID — two of them don't, and we paper over it with a suppression window. The suppression config is fragile; change it only with a canary. Ask Orla Venn before touching partition counts. Everything else I know is written up on the internal page below.

runbook for badug-kadup: https://confluence.zemvarlabs.internal/projects/browse/display/projects/bd1b